hey,
i havent been diagnosed with anything but have been told i dissociate, well i know i do it now sometimes. My therapist has gone over grouding techniques with me, to do after it happens to 'bring me back', but I was wondering if anyone knows if there is something you can do when you feel it first start to happen? or to stop yourself doing it before it happens. because i kind of know whats going to trigger it, and i think i can stay in control, but then i cant

learn to "ground". feel where you feel best in your body. feel it? good. then feel where the "bad"stuff is taking place. Notice it? picture a better result...flashback to where someone hurt you? picture a new ending- like...hurting them, sending them into space, having them shrink and blow away...etc. then turn your thought back to where you feel most comfrotable in your body...learn to feel and to recognize what you are feeling- don't judge what you feel or think- just accept it- as a part of YOU...I find it helpful to feel my body mentally and then reach out and touch something while telling myself I am a grown woman now and what happened happened in the past. But i still get shocked sometimes- blown away and I don't ground myself...but hey..nobodys perfect! ;D good luck!
